Vulture debuted in April 2007 as an entertainment blog on nymag.com, the website of New York Magazine. [2] Melissa Maerz and Dan Kois were the founding editors. [2] [4] The initial focus was television and film news, especially recaps of recent television episodes.

"Vaulter" is the second episode of the second season of the American satirical comedy-drama television series Succession, and the 12th episode overall. It was written by Jon Brown and directed by Andrij Parekh , and originally aired on HBO on August 18, 2019.
